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ister interacts with Self-Help Group beneficiaries, including national-level players

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Mohan Yadav engaged with beneficiaries of Self-Help Groups (SHGs) in Barwani district under the National Rural Livelihoods Mission. The event saw women from various sectors sharing their experiences, with Seema Nargawe, known as ‘Drone Didi’, highlighting her journey in organic farming and drone operation after joining an SHG. She now trains other women in these practices, enhancing their livelihoods.

National-level hockey player Sneha Mohaniya, who has secured medals at the national level, raised concerns about inadequate sports facilities and requested an astro-turf in Barwani for better training. Chief Minister Yadav pledged to address this need promptly. Additionally, he directed officials to ensure state-level shooting training for Vaishnavi Mahule, offering recognition and a financial incentive to a local coach for his efforts in training girls.

In his closing remarks, Chief Minister Yadav emphasized the state government’s commitment to supporting women, rural communities, farmers, and sportspersons through various welfare schemes, aiming to foster progress and empowerment across society.
